The strong winds and extreme smoky conditions made fighting the fire difficult today. For safety reasons most fire crews pulled back to the Frenchman’s area of Warm Springs Creek earlier today. As of 8 p.m. on August 18th the fire was still growing rapidly. It is well over 3,000 acres and is burning northeasterly, currently heading up Rooks Creek towards Warm Springs ridge and the head of Adams Gulch.

I watched the fire from 8,200’ at the Silver Lake trailhead late this afternoon and evening and provided some observations to the Fire Chief. It was boiling rapidly and consuming large stands of green trees as evidenced by large columns of black smoke.
